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Area: Larger areas require more time and resources to clear.
- Density of Vegetation: Heavily wooded areas with thick underbrush are more labor-intensive.
- Type of Trees: Different tree species can vary in size and difficulty to remove.
- Terrain: Steep or uneven terrain can complicate the clearing process.
- Accessibility: Easily accessible sites are less costly to clear than remote or hard-to-reach areas.
-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local laws and obtaining necessary permits can add to the cost.
- Equipment Required: Specialized machinery and tools can increase expenses.
- Disposal of Debris: Costs associated with removing and disposing of cleared vegetation.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Monroe Township, NJ) |
---|---|
Basic Land Clearing | $1,200 - $4,000 per acre |
Tree Removal | $200 - $1,000 per tree |
Stump Grinding | $100 - $300 per stump |
Brush Clearing | $20 - $200 per hour |
Debris Removal | $50 - $100 per hour |
Site Preparation | $1,500 - $5,000 per acre |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
